I upgraded to Xen 4.12.2 recently and since the upgrade, I am unable to start
more than 14 domUs.
The error, when trying to start the 15th, is:
Parsing config from /etc/xen/boot/stage7/dbtest
libxl: error: libxl_xshelp.c:265:libxl__xs_transaction_commit: could not
commit xenstore transaction: No space left on device
libxl: error: libxl_xshelp.c:265:libxl__xs_transaction_commit: could not
commit xenstore transaction: No space left on device
libxl: error: libxl_create.c:1318:domcreate_launch_dm: Domain 20:unable to add
disk devices
libxl: error: libxl_domain.c:1038:libxl__destroy_domid: Domain 20:Non-existant
domain
libxl: error: libxl_domain.c:993:domain_destroy_callback: Domain 20:Unable to
destroy guest
libxl: error: libxl_domain.c:920:domain_destroy_cb: Domain 20:Destruction of
domain failed
The domUs showing the issue get the disks from a driver-domain.
All this was working correctly using older Xen versions and no config changes
have been done.
Unfortunately, I am unable to find anything further in the logs and my google-
fu is not helping either as all I find is for much older versions.
If anyone has any further ideas on how to further analyse this?
If I stop 1 domU, I am able to start another one, so I am confident it has to
do with amount of domUs running and not a specific domU.
